First problem I sees is the way too much F***ing DIRT!! Use a carb cleaner on the carb. Second if it runs and stays on take to a car wash. This will help find a leak, damage hose and other simple problems.
What is the initial timing set at? How old is the fuel pump? Fuel filter?
